Hey does anyone know of the regional situation in Europe and/how the hiring looks there? I have 1210 TT 850 mulit, and 825 Turbine. Is there any airline that would consider me for employment? Any info would be great. Thanks.

Do you have a JAA frozen ATPL and the right to live and work in the EU?

If not, trust me and forget about it.

If ya do, you can get on with around 250 hours as the graduate of an integrated course from a JAA FTO. One of the most popular is the company for which I work, Oxford Aviation Academy.

It'll only cost you about $164,000.

Or you can do the modular course, since you already have the FAA licenses, for about half that.

....AND you have to do your IR and MCC rating in the UK....it'll take about 2-3 months...maybe longer.

Oh, and you have to sit the 14 JAA written exams....count on a bare minimum of 5 months of intensive, full-time self study to pass those.
